My Lovely tilda was coloured with promarkers and Spectrum noir pencils, the paper is from a digi kit i downlaoded from etsy.  The butterlfy die cut along the edge is a tonic one and the embelishements were from my stash.  The sentiment is from the crafters companion die'sire sets. The shaker stuff insude is a combination of pink fine glitter and white micro beads.


This one is a Lili of the Valley stamp, which i cut out and coloured again with promarkers and spectrum noir pencils.  the paper are from a Paperstack pad.  The sentiment is anotehr die'sire one, but this time form the Christmas set.  I used my sillhouette machine to cut out the snow flakes and pine cone embellishment and inked the edges of this too.  The bow is made from a section of florist ribbon.  The bits inside are a combination of snow glitter and tiny whiote micro beads.

Here is mine - this is the second one I made.  My first attempt I had almost finished the colouring, and I forgot to clean the end of my paper stump, and smudged blue pencil all over her face.  As this wasn't an image of a smurf - I sort of ruined it!  Oh well...

Its my first go at no line colouring (or it think that's what its called anyway)  I printed her in grey so the lines are hardly seen.  I have also been practicing with my spectrum noir pencils again.  Practice makes perfect or so they say, so I'll keep on practicing!





the backing card is just plain cream and I stamped and embossed glittery butterflies on it.  The black circles are a doily die, finished with some pretty flowers from my every growing stash.
